Despite their second album, Pretty. Odd., only being out for less than a month, Panic At The Disco have already begun work on album number three.
According to guitarist / band leader Ryan Ross, the Las Vegas emo heores have already penned "nine or ten" songs for the effort.
"We've written a bunch of songs since recording Pretty. Odd.," Ross told Billboard. "We've probably got about nine or ten new songs going right now, so I hope that after our tour and all that, we can do another record."
When asked on the direction of the new material, Ross responded: "It's basically picking up where we left off. Because Pretty. Odd. was a lot different for a lot of reasons, I think we're kind of finding something we're drawn to, and the stuff so far definitely sounds harder to place to me. I'm not really exactly sure what it sounds like - I guess sometimes that's a good thing."
